How many people would be interested in buying a TOP quality waterproof, lightweight Hi-viz jacket as worn by the Gardai but obviously without the Garda livery. I have one and they are a fantastic piece of kit for everyone but particularly those doing big mileage and commuting. I think others will concur when I say that trying to find a Hi-viz jacket suitable for the needs of motorcyclists is nigh-on impossible, however this one DOES fit the bill (pardon the pun). some features as follows:
- 100% waterproof
- lightweight
- inside pockets (zipper pockets)
- outside deep pockets
- incredibly effective 'REFLEXITE' reflective banding.
- button down flap down the length of the zip to preserve waterproofing.
- machine washable (brings them up like new.)

Seriously - these jackets are fantastic ... 2.5 years of daily commuting and the worst of the weather kept at bay ... the only glitch I've had is the reflective panels on the sleeves are beginning to show wear, but I'd be lying if I said I'd been kind to the jacket ... it gets properly abused
9 hours in torrential rain in the west, and not a drop let in ... worst impact was the cuffs were a touch moist
